Concerns Over AI Misuse in legal Filings
Introduction
New Delhi: As India takes center stage in the realm of artificial intelligence by hosting the prestigious AI Impact Summit-2026, significant concerns have emerged regarding the inappropriate use of AI in legal documentation. The Supreme Court of India has recently called attention to this alarming trend, particularly in the context of legal filings made by attorneys.
Supreme Court’s Alarm Over AI Usage
A bench led by Chief Justice Surya Kant expressed its grave concerns during a recent hearing. The Justices were dismayed to find that some lawyers are increasingly relying on AI tools to draft legal petitions. This reliance has led to the alarming phenomenon of citations of fictitious judgments, such as “Mercy vs Mankind,” which do not exist in legal records.
Eyewitness Accounts of Misrepresentation
Justice B V Nagarathna noted a particularly troubling incident involving the alleged citation of the non-existent case “Mercy vs Mankind.” Chief Justice Kant recounted a comparable situation in Justice Dipankar Datta’s court, where numerous dubious judgments were cited in legal arguments.
Burden on the Judiciary
Justice Nagarathna elaborated on the problematic scenario by noting that, although some cited judgments may indeed be real, lawyers often embellish or misattribute quotes, complicating the verification process for judges. “This situation creates an additional burden on the judges,” she pointed out, emphasizing the detrimental impact of such practices on the judicial system.
The Decline of legal Drafting Skills
Justice Joymalya Bagchi contributed to the discussion by highlighting a concerning trend in the art of legal drafting. He observed that many special leave petitions tend to comprise extensive quotations from previous judgments with little original legal reasoning. This reflects a decline in the skills necessary for effective legal argumentation and originality.
